Everyone keeps mentioning "coding" the keys. I don't believe anything is done to the keys, rather the procedure sets the car to recognize the keys. Each key is probably encoded with a unique number that the car is set to recognize as a "legal ID" that will allow the car to operate. That would be why you need two different keys to program a third. The car's electronics needs to see the two "Legal ID" numbers, each of which should be unique and already recognized) before it will register the third NEW Legal ID Number as a valid ID. The system in the car will also have a maximum number of ID numbers that it can store at one time and it may not be able to write over previously stored numbers if there is a lifetime maximum that is reached. Originally Posted by takahashi
Got the Colour Coded key from Mazda as a pre-order present

Went to the dealer to Code it. I saw them done on the spot...

HEY ... In fact... YOU DON"T NEED TO GO THERE! YOU CAN DO IT YOURSELF!

Procedure to code key:

Require:
2 coded keys (not your service/valet key please)
1 Uncoded key (Your new key)
Your 8
Yourself with a working hand
Have you service/valet key ready. In case you F up

Steps:

1 - Put your 1st coded key. Turn on to standby mode/pre-ignition mode but not starting the engine. Wait for 4 seconds.

2 - Put your 2nd coded key. Turn on to standby mode/pre-ignition mode and wait for 4 seconds.

3 - Put your uncoded key in. Turn on to standby mode/pre-ignition mode and wait for 4 seconds.

4 - Test all the keys.

Should work. If you have F up the keys, use the service/valet key to drive up to the dealer. :)

Enjoy

Originally Posted by StealthTL
I have another one for you....

Bought a new remote opener and found the way to code it from the dealers manual -

(The door switch is the little rubber one on the jamb of the rear door, which controls the interior lights.)

Key in,
Ignition On/Off, 3 times,
Push door switch, 3times,
- Car will lock, then unlock-
Push 'Lock' on first remote, 2 times,
~ ~ ~ second ~ , 2 times,
~ ~ ~ third (new) , 2 times,

Now all 3 are accepted by the car.
